What does this charge mean?

This statute sets out what must appear in an indictment's heading and closing language. An indictment must name Tennessee, the county, and the specific court; state when the indictment was filed; and end with the phrase "against the peace and dignity of the state of Tennessee." This is a procedural requirement with no criminal penalty—failure to comply may make the indictment defective.

An indictment must contain in the caption or body of the indictment, the name of the state, county and court; the term in and at which the indictment is preferred; and must conclude “against the peace and dignity of the state of Tennessee.”
